Real Hotels & Resorts expands in Central America

Real Hotels & Resorts (RHR) is planning to double in size over the next two years.

Tuesday, September 23, 2008

The new projects, which should all be completed at the end of the next year, are spread over Central America from San Pedro Sula (Honduras), to the expansion of the Real Quality Hotel (Airport) in El Salvador, to a new project - Club Tower - annexed to the Real InterContinental Hotel in Escazu, San Jose (Costa Rica). Investments continue in ever growing tourist zone in Guanacaste on the pacific coast of Costa Rica; they are also investing in Panama and are invading a very promising market, that of Colombia.

El Salvador: Barceló Enters the Salvadoran Market

June 2016

The hotel chain has announced the purchase of a five-star 205 room hotel in San Salvador, and is preparing for July 26 to open under the name Barceló San Salvador

The hotel chain which acquired the hotel is located in the capital in the commercial and business sector of San Benito. The hotel has two restaurants, a bar, outdoor pool, gym, health and beauty center, parking and 12 meeting rooms which can accommodate from 10 to 800 people.

Intercontinental Invests $5 Million in Technology

September 2009

Real Hotels & Resorts announced state-of-the-art technology upgrades for all its hotels in Central America.

Sound-proof meeting rooms, 25 giant screens for video conferences, and high-speed internet services are some of the innovations to be developed.

Fernando Poma, vice president of the hotel division of Salvadoran conglomerate Grupo Poma, told ElPeriodico.com.gt: "We have one objective: to be 5 years ahead of the competition by means of a process of constant innovation. Being the only hotel chain providing all these services helps us to be chosen by our customers".

Hotel Real Internacontinental expands in Costa Rica

July 2008

Hotel Real Intercontinental will open its new 40-million-dollar Torre Club Internacional in San José, Costa Rica on August 15.

The complex is composed of eight floors and will operate as a club and tower for exclusive guests. It will have 98 guest rooms, including 15 suites.
